Human Resource Management BSc (Hons) at the Ulster University
Human resource management BSc (Hons) is a full-time graduation program of Ulster university that is focused on professional skill development and expertise development in the student related to the field to help them learn human resource management and increase their organizational effectiveness. Ulster university’s this degree under UCAS code N600 under university code U20 for the Ulster university is starting on September 2023 under the department of management, leadership, and marketing. Ulster university’s this course is designed with proper research and updated according to industry requirements through the process of academic revalidation. Ulster university through practical working opportunity and assignment writing by the student under each module help participant learn the practical as well as the conceptual aspect of the course. Ulster University provides its student with a scholarship, awards, and prizes on the basis of their expertise in academics, music, sports, etc. various awards like the dean award for students averaging 70% or more than that, Lynas award for the best placement student, and Capita prize for best final year student. Ulster university ranked the highest in the national student survey of 2014, 2015, and 2017&2019 in the undergraduate human resource management degree in the United Kingdom based on the student satisfaction of the university. Career opportunities available for the student passed out as human resource management from the Ulster university are Human resource administration officer, Human resource assistant, human Administrator, Human Resource Advisor, Assistant/Service member, and Human resource officer. Ulster University provides the student with a one-year professional work placement opportunity that help the student learn a skill and develop their networking in the field and test their career path before graduating. It helps student enhance their confidence and get workplace exposure and discover new opportunities in their career. Ulster University also offers the student a chance to placement and study abroad to further increase their exposure.
